Yes, the Metro covers central Tokyo very well, but the stations are for the most part in obscure places. You usually have to walk 10-15 minutes from a station to get anywhere of any significance. There are of course exceptions, and the Toei lines are closer to places, but more expensive to use.

Basically, you can get everywhere in Tokyo on a 700 yen standard Metro day pass, but be prepared to do some walking as well. The JR is good if you're sticking to the loop, and it does cover most of the major places. But I tend to stay in Asakusa when I go to Tokyo, and that isn't on the JR, so I stick with the Metro pass.
